This is all the FCC reveals about the possible Realme 8 specifications. Separately, rumours have revealed that the Realme 8 series, which is expected to include two models, will tout the Snapdragon chipset with 4G connectivity. The vanilla Realme 8 is said to come with the Snapdragon 720G chipset, while the Realme 8 Pro may employ the Snapdragon 730G SoC. The 5G variants of the phones are also rumoured, but their chipset remains under the wraps. The alleged TENAA listing of Realme 8 suggests that it may come with a 5,000mAh battery, 6.5-inch punch-hole display, and triple rear cameras.
Additionally, Realme has confirmed that the Realme 8 Pro will pack a 108MP Samsung HM2 sensor and Realme X7 series-like design. The Realme 8 Pro will also tout quad-camera setup and features like a Starry Mode time-lapse, tilt-shift photography mode, and more.
